The mole of the Russian oligarch inside the FBI

The mole of the Russian oligarch inside the FBI

A former senior FBI official in charge of investigations into Russian oligarchs has been accused of being on the payroll of one of them while employed by the US Federal Police.

Charles McGonigal, FBI’s New York-based counterintelligence chief from 2016 to 2018, Accused of serving Oleg Deripaska, an aluminum magnate who was once the richest man in Russia. He is considered an ally of Putin and has ties to Russian organized crime.

The case is embarrassing for the FBI, which is currently conducting politically sensitive investigations into Trump and Biden’s handling of classified documents. Congressional Republicans are preparing to open investigations into the organization, accusing it of bias in favor of Democrats.

Oligarchs and the Trump Campaign

Deripaska had business dealings — we’re talking millions of dollars — with Paul Manafort, Trump’s campaign manager in 2016, who was at the center of allegations of Russian interference in the presidential election.

Esteemed Columnist Philadelphia Inquirer Will Bunch reports that Manafort shared key campaign data with a Russian linked to Deripaska.

Late in the campaign, with the polls leading for Hillary Clinton, Trump attorney Rudy Giuliani told Fox News that the Republican nominee had “a surprise or two that you’ll hear about in the next few days.” I mean, I’m talking about really big surprises.” Giuliani later bragged about having FBI sources.

When FBI Director James Comey revealed that an investigation was underway into emails from Hillary Clinton that allegedly contained classified information, The New York Times Dedicate a front page article to her.

Citing the then “intelligence sources”, prof times You mentioned that the FBI could not monitor the Russian interference on behalf of Trump as asserted by Clinton and the Democrats. Both stories were picked up by all American media. This information was wrong. blow to Clinton.

Will Bunch quotes an expert who believes it costs Clinton enough percentage points to prevent him from getting an Electoral College majority. US intelligence later concluded that the Russians had indeed interfered in the election.

McGonigal, source times?

Who leaked misinformation about Clinton and made sure that The New York Times That Russia wasn’t trying to help Trump win the election?

Bunch wonders if it was McGonigal who misled America’s most influential news outlet.

An investigation by Justice Department Inspector General Michael Horowitz of the FBI’s New York office lasted four years and failed to find the source of the leaks.
